      • Stellite 6 합금의 열간 압연 특성

        백응률,심종필,김판권 영남대학교 공업기술연구소 2001 工業技術硏究所論文集 Vol.29 No.1

        The aim of the investigation was to study the effect of hot working on the tensile properties of the Stellite 6 alloy, normally used in the form of castings. To determine most suitable hot working temperature, firstly specimens were preheated so as to obtain maximum deformation without cracking, upsetting tests were preformed at temperatures ranging from 1150 to 1300℃ at intervals of 50℃. As the result, the deformation of 35% without cracking is possible at 1250℃. Both cast and hot worked specimens were investigated microstructure, composition of carbides, constituting phase and hardness of specimens by using SEM and tensile test was carried out in order to know tensile properties of specimens. As the result of observing Microstructure, hot workings breakdowns eutectic carbide network in the Stellite 6 alloy, and eutectic carbides are aligned in rolling direction. The result of the tensile test, hot worked specimen is much higher than the casting specimen in the tensile properties.

        한국형 지역사회경찰활동의 발전방안

        최응렬,박상진 동국대학교 사회과학연구원 2008 사회과학연구 Vol.14 No.2

        이 논문에서는 우리나라 뿐 아니라 여러 국가에서 경찰활동으로 경찰개혁의 한 부분인 지역사회 경찰활동을 평가하기 위한 것이다. 특히 이러한 경찰활동이 지역사회와 지역주민들의 안전, 삶의 질에 어떠한 긍정적인 영향을 가져왔는지를 검증해 우리나라 실정에 알맞은 경찰개혁의 일부분으로서의 지역사회 경찰활동의 발전방향을 모색해 보고자 하는 것이 주된 목적이라 할 수 있다. 우리나라는 아직도 전통적 경찰활동 방식에 젖어 있어 지역사회 경찰활동에 대하여 부정적 견해를 보이고 있다. 그리하여 우리나라 경찰활동의 대부분은 사후 대응적인 역할에 머물러 있는 실정이다. 이러한 현상은 지역사회 경찰활동 개념에 대한 인식의 부족과 이에 대한 적절한 교육의 부재에서 그 원인을 찾을 수 있다. 따라서 우리나라에서 효율적인 경찰활동을 수행하기 위해서 선행요건으로 첫째, 경찰의 정치적 독립과 수사권 독립 둘째, 조직의 분권화 셋째, 경찰관의 역할 정립 넷째, 경찰의 이미지개선이 선행 되어야 한다. 이러한 선행요건으로 지역사회 경찰활동의 발전적 방안으로는 첫째, 지역경찰제의 활성화 둘째, 시민의 자발적 참여 유도 셋째, 자치단체 지역공공단체와 협력강화 넷째, 순찰의 내실화 다섯째, 시민경찰학교의 활성화를 통하여 지역사회 경찰활동을 하루 빨리 정착 시켜야 할 것이다. 물고기가 물을 떠나서는 살수 없듯이 경찰은 지역과 지역주민을 떠나서는 존재의 가치가 없다. 이러한 관계를 정확히 인식하고 지역주민들과 유기적 협조체제를 유지하는 ‘지역사회 경찰활동󰡑을 하루빨리 정착시켜 급변하는 현대사회에서 파생하는 각종 신종범죄에 효율적으로 대응하는 사회공존 협력체제를 만들어 보다 더 친절하고 공정한 경찰로 재탄생이 되어야 할 것이다. This article aims for evaluating the community policing as a part of police reform not only in Korea but also in other nations. Especially, this article focuses on examination of community policing whether it brought the positive effects on the safety and the quality of life in the community and their residents, and tries to find a desirable direction of community policing as a police reform. Korean still has a negative view of the community policing because they are get used to the traditional one. Most of the policing we receive remain, therefore, reactive. This present situation comes from the lack of perception on community policing and proper training and education of it. Accordingly, to perform the effective policing in Korea, at first, political and police prosecution independence of Police, second, the decentralization of police organization, third, the establishment on role of police, and the last, the improvement of image on police are needed to precede. Based on these factors, the revitalization of local police system and citizen police academies, the inducement of citizens's participation and the reinforcement of cooperation between local organizations and substance of patrol are indicated to settle down the community policing. Police won't be recognized unless they are not attached to the community and their residents. It is needed to perceive this relation and settle down the community policing, and it is also needed to recreate the kinder and fairer police consequently in rapidly changing modern society.

      • Fe-C-Cr-Mo-V계 공구강의 미세조직과 건식 긁힘 마멸 거동 (마모재 : Al₂O₃)

        백응률,최상호 영남대학교 재료기술연구소 2000 재료기술연구 Vol.1 No.1

        High carbon- high chromium tool steels display a number of advantages in abr asive wear applications. They contain moderat e amounts of chromium that produces massive chromium- rich carbides in an austenitic matrix of sufficient hardenability to be transformed to martensit e with relatively simple heat treatment . In this study the role of vanadium- rich carbides with high hardness as well as chromium- rich carbides in improving abrasive wear resistance was investigat ed using a series of Fe- C- Cr -Mo- V system alloys with varying carbide volume fr action. The abr asive wear resistance of the alloys against Al₂O₃ harder than chromium- rich carbides but softer than vanadium- rich carbides was measured with a dry abrasive rubber wheel abr asion test. The abr asive wear resist ance was affected by a volume fraction and variety of carbide because of a differance of hardness between carbide and abrasive. As a result, The specimen with the most volume fraction of vanadium- rich carbide harder than Al2O3 had the mot excellent abrasive wear resistance.

      • Fe-C-Cr-Mo-V합금의 건식 긁힘 마멸 거동(마모재 : SiO₂)

        백응률,최상호 영남대학교 공업기술연구소 2000 工業技術硏究所論文集 Vol.28 No.1

        High carbon-high chromium tool steels display a number of advantages in abrasive wear applications. They contain moderate amounts of chromium that produces massive chromium-rich carbides in an austenitic matrix of sufficient hardenability to be transformed to martensite with relatively simple heat treatment. In this study the role of vanadium-rich carbides with high hardness as well as chromium-rich carbides in improving abrasive wear resistance was investigated using a series of Fe-C-Cr-Mo-V system alloys with varying carbide volume fraction. The abrasive wear resistance of the alloys against SiO2 softer than vanadium-rich carbide and chromium-rich carbide was measured with a dry abrasive rubber wheel abrasion test. The abrasive wear resistance was affected by a volume fraction and variety of carbide because of a differance of hardness between carbide and abrasive. As a result, The specimen with the most volume fraction of the total of carbide volume fraction had the most excellent abrasive wear resistance.

        인구구조의 변화와 노인문제

        김응렬 고려대학교 한국학연구소 2003 한국학연구 Vol.18 No.-

        The purpose of this paper is to analyze change of age structure and aging problems. According to NSO(The National Statistical Office), South Korea has become ahing society. The population of the aged is increasing rapidly as a result of better living conditions and the advancement medical technology. Meanwhile, TFR(Total Fortile Rates) is decreasing rapidly as a result of change of social environment, such as women's high educational level achievement and participation in economic activities, late marriage in life and transformation of women's life style. Population Aged 65 and Over(in thousands) and TFR Selected Years. (본문참조) Compared with other developed countries, the numbers of the aged is not yet serious problem in South Korea. South Korea has a strong tradition of family support for the elderly but now this has weakened family support. The central and local government is tasked with preparing a social safety net.

      • M_(7)C₃형 크롬탄화물의 경도에 미치는 고용원소(V, Mo, Mn)의 영향

        백응률,유국종,정재영,안상호 영남대학교 재료기술연구소 2000 재료기술연구 Vol.1 No.1

        This study makes an investigation into the effect of dissolved alloy element (V,Mo,Mn) on hardness of the M_(7)C₃ type chromium carbide. Dis solved alloy element (V,Mo,Mn) content in M_(7)C₃ type chromium carbide was analyzed by EDS and micro- hardness of the M_(7)C₃ type chromium carbide was measured by micro- Vicker s hardness tester . Increasing to V, Mo content in specimen, result to increasing dissolved V, Mo content in M_(7)C₃ type chromium carbide. Also hardnes s of M_(7)C₃ type chromium carbide was increased. At this point , V added specimen was superior to Mo added specimen. According as Mn content in specimen increases , Mn cont ent in M_(7)C₃ type chromium carbide some increased but hardness in M_(7)C₃ type chromium carbide some decreased.

      • TMP의 감마 放射線分解에 있어서의 할로벤젠에 의한 Electron-scavenging에 關한 硏究

        金應洌 漢陽大學校 環境科學硏究所 1983 環境科學論文集 Vol.4 No.-

        TMP의 방사선분해에 의한 메탄과 수소생성을 electron-scavenger(halobenzene)의 거동으로 연구하였다. electron-scavenger는 메탄의 수율에 대해서는 미비한 효과였지만, 수소의 수율을 억제함을 알 수 있었다. Hummel의 실험식으로부터 얻은 실험적파라미터 α는 6.5ℓ/㏖였으며 ??+??의 값은 3.5를 얻었다. The formation of methane and hydrogen in the γ-radiolysis of TMP has been studied in the presence of an electron-scavenger(halobenzene). Electron-scavenger are found to depress the hydrogen yield and have only a slight effect on the methane yield. From Hummel empirical equation, empirical parameter(α) was obtain 6.5ℓ/㏖. The value of ??, ?? thus obtained are 3.5.

      • 사람 적혈구 막에 있어서 Carnitine acyltransferase 효소에 관한 연구

        박중근,김응렬,조기승 漢陽大學校敎養學部 1976 硏究論文集 Vol.- No.1

        사람 적혈구막에서 palmitoyl carnitine을 생성하는 효소계의 존재를 확인하였는데 이 효소계에 의해 palmitoyl coenzyme A와 DL-Carnitine(methyl-14C)으로부터 palmitoyl carnitine-14C이 생합성됨을 고찰하였고, 한편 이 효소계에 의해 화학적으로 합성한 palmitoyl-14C-carnitine이 palmitic acid-14C과 carnitine으로 가수분해됨을 확인하였다. 이 효소계에 의해서나 또는 화학적 방법에 의해 만들어진 palmitoyl carnitine은 적혈구막을 용해하며 이때 막에 부착된 효소계인 Adenosine Triphosphatase나 Glucose-6-phosphatase등이 활성화됨을 발견하였다. An enzyme system in human erythrocyte membrane was found to catalyze the formation of palmitoyl carnitine-14C from palmitoyl coenzyme A and carnitine-(methyl-14C). It was also confirmed that the same enzyme acts on the hydrolysis of palmitoyl-14C-carnitine into palmitic acid-14C and carnitine. Palmitoyl carnitine formed from this enzyme system or other chemical method solubilized the erythrocyte membrane and stimulated significantly the membrane bound enzymes, such as Adeno-sine Triphosphatase (ATPase) and Glucose-6-phosphatase (G-6-Pase) tried.
